Terminal galactose-containing cell-surface glycans are complex carbohydrate structures located on the exterior of cell membranes, characterized by a galactose residue at the non-reducing end of the glycan chain. These molecules are essential for various biological processes, including cell-cell recognition, adhesion, and the regulation of immune responses through interactions with endogenous lectins like galectins. In healthy states, terminal galactose is often capped by sialic acid; however, in many diseases, particularly cancer, aberrant glycosylation leads to the exposure of these terminal residues, such as the Thomsen-Friedenreich (TF) antigen, which promotes tumor invasion and metastasis. These glycans also serve as critical attachment points for pathogens and potent toxins, such as the Ricin B chain, which exploits them for cellular entry. From a therapeutic perspective, they are targeted for selective drug delivery and toxin-mediated cell killing, and their varying levels on proteins like IgG serve as important biomarkers for inflammation, aging, and metabolic disorders.
Drugs or toxins interact with these glycans by binding to the terminal galactose residues, which can trigger receptor-mediated endocytosis (as seen with Ricin), facilitate pathogen attachment (e.g., AAV9), or mediate immune effector functions like antibody-dependent cellular cytotoxicity (ADCC) and complement-dependent cytotoxicity (CDC) when targeted by specific antibodies.
